摘要
The differential formalism introduced by J. Chandezon during the seventies has been successfully applied to the study of waveguides and to diffraction problems. Until now it was believed that the method could be applied only if the interfaces between media were described by graphs of functions. We show that an eigen-operator formulation of the method allows one to solve a larger set of profiles. This theoretical result is applied to gratings having a vertical facet.
